So the `pixlcrush resize --batch` command silently skips portrait images when `--max-width` is set but `--max-height` isn't. Future maintainers: the culprit is the aspect-ratio guard in `scaler.go`, which bails early instead of falling back to the default bound. Rena patched it on the `fix/portrait-skip` branch but we never merged because the golden-file tests were flaky on the Tarwick runners. Repro with the sample set in `testdata/mixed_orient`. The failing run is identified by the token below.

session token of tajog-fahaf = htk21_4ae55819f45410afcb307

The `lintgate-baseline.json` file records accepted findings for the Ketterbridge monorepo. Regenerate it only after triaging every new finding; never suppress a finding to unblock a release. Run `lintgate regen --strict`, confirm the diff contains only triaged entries, and attach the diff to the review ticket. The regeneration job uploads the new baseline to the internal Findings Registry, which requires authenticated access. Use the service key below when invoking the upload step from the runner.

API key for tagef-fafop: vxb2-ta

The on-call alert fired at 02:14 when the MeasureMate recipe-scaling calculator's update feed began rejecting the 5.1.3 artifact with a bad-signature error. Root cause: the build was produced after last week's key rotation but the feed manifest still references the retired key. Impact is limited to auto-updates; existing installs function normally. Remediation is to republish the manifest with the current key and re-trigger verification. The active signing key is included below.

deploy key for kajof-fajop: bky6_gDHw9Q

Step 4: Enable GPU memory profiling for VrammScope on the Oltara cluster. Support staff should confirm the profiler daemon is pinned to version 2.3 before capturing traces, since older builds misreport fragmentation. Update the node's env file carefully; a typo here disables sampling silently. Add the profiler's auth line directly beneath this sentence.

env line for fafof-fahag: LEDGER_TOKEN5=f8790